Overview:
Two gripping novels from Conn Iggulden that plunge readers into the blood-soaked rise of Rome’s rulers. This 2-book collection presents Tyrant and Nero, offering a sweeping, cinematic view of power, family, and ambition at the heart of the empire. Tyrant traces the ruthless path to succession as Claudius weds Agrippina and Nero is adopted, forging alliances and enemies alike. The narrative weaves together court intrigue, dramatic decisions, and a boy’s early education under mentors like Seneca, all set against a backdrop where every choice echoes through generations. In Nero, the drama intensifies as the emperor-to-be confronts a web of conspiracies, loyalties, and rivalries that test his resolve and shape a dynasty. Book-by-Book Guide:
Tyrant — In Tyrant, Conn Iggulden dramatizes Rome’s power corridors from a marriage that catalyzes political bloodletting to a succession drama that reshapes the imperial line. Agrippina’s ascent destabilizes traditional order as Claudius adopts Nero, elevating a boy to the throne’s threshold while Britannicus watches from the wings. Nero’s early formation is guided by Seneca, setting up a lifelong tension between intellect and ambition. The narrative threads together court intrigue, martial politics, and the fragility of legacy, offering a vivid portrait of a city where every ally could become an enemy. The result is a gripping start to a dynastic saga that asks how much mercy history grants to those who dare to grasp power.

Nero — Nero plunges readers into AD 37, where the imperial stage is crowded with danger and opportunity in equal measure. Agrippina presses forward with relentless resolve, while rival factions and conspirators close in. The closer you are to the empire’s heart, the more perilous the path to control becomes. Nero’s education deepens as he navigates deadly political currents, balancing familial expectations with personal ambition. The tension escalates as the emperor’s fate hangs in the balance amid betrayals, loyalties, and battles of wit.
